What my online signature means

My online signature is an electronic signature used to sign documents digitally instead of on paper. In signNow, a signer reviews the document, confirms intent, and applies a signature through a browser or mobile device. The platform records the signing event, captures timestamps and identity details, and preserves a tamper-evident audit trail. That makes the process faster to complete, easier to track, and suitable for routine business agreements, forms, and approvals across U.S. workflows.

Why my online signature matters

My online signature reduces paper handling, shortens turnaround time, and supports enforceability when the signer’s intent, consent, and record integrity are preserved under ESIGN and UETA.

Common my online signature challenges

  • Signers may delay completion when the process requires too many steps or unclear instructions.
  • Documents can become disputed if identity checks, timestamps, or audit records are incomplete.
  • Teams may lose track of versions when templates, routing, and approvals are not controlled.
  • Compliance gaps appear when retention, access controls, or consent records are not documented.

Best practices for online signatures

A careful setup helps keep signing fast, defensible, and easier to manage across teams and document types.

Define the workflow first

Use clear signer roles, required fields, and routing order before sending. A defined workflow reduces confusion, limits rework, and helps each signer understand what they need to complete.

Match authentication to risk

Match authentication strength to document sensitivity. Use stronger verification for regulated or high-value records, and keep the method consistent across similar document types.

Maintain clean templates

Keep templates current and remove unused fields. Standardized templates reduce setup errors, support repeat use, and make it easier to compare completed records later.

Control retention and access

Set retention and access rules before rollout. Store completed files with the audit trail, and limit access to people who need the record for business or compliance reasons.

What the audit trail records

The audit trail captures identity, timing, integrity, and retrieval details that support later review.

01

Signer authentication:

Verifies the signer before the record is accepted.
02

Timestamp capture:

Captures UTC time for each signing event.
03

Document hashing:

Calculates a hash of the signed file.
04

Tamper-evident sealing:

Applies a tamper-evident seal after completion.
05

Audit record:

Stores the event history with the completed document.
06

Retrieval and export:

Exports the trail for review or evidence use.
